NCT ID: NCT03746275 Completed - Atherosclerosis Clinical Trials

Study to Gain Insights in Treatment Patterns and Outcomes in Patients With Atherosclerosis Prescribed to Xarelto in Combination With Acetylsalicylic Acid

XATOA
Start date: November 13, 2018
Phase:
Study type: Observational

In this study researchers want to gain more information on treatment patterns of patients treated with Xarelto in combination with acetylsalicylic acid (ASA). Both drugs reduce the risk of blood clots via different pathways. The study will enroll adult patients suffering from coronary artery disease (narrowing or blockage of vessels that supply the heart with blood) or peripheral artery disease (narrowing or blockage of vessels that supply the legs or head with blood). The study will focus on information on when and why physicians are starting to treat patients with Xarelto in addition to ASA, treatment duration, reasons to discontinue treatment and previous therapies. The study will also look into treatment outcomes for patients being treated with a combination of Xarelto and ASA by their physicians.

NCT ID: NCT03739112 Completed - Clinical trials for Respiratory Tract Infections

Efficacy of a Plant-derived Quadrivalent Virus-like Particle (VLP) Vaccine in the Elderly

Start date: September 18, 2018
Phase: Phase 3
Study type: Interventional

This Phase 3 study was intended to assess the relative efficacy of the Quadrivalent VLP Influenza Vaccine during the 2018-2019 influenza season compared to a licensed vaccine in elderly adults 65 years of age and older. One dose of VLP Influenza Vaccine (30 μg/strain) or of Comparator (15 μg/strain) was to be administered to 12,738 participants.

NCT ID: NCT03735121 Active, not recruiting - Clinical trials for Non-Small Cell Lung Cancer

A Study to Investigate Atezolizumab Subcutaneous in Patients With Previously Treated Locally Advanced or Metastatic Non-Small Cell Lung Cancer

Start date: December 14, 2018
Phase: Phase 3
Study type: Interventional

This study will evaluate the pharmacokinetics, safety, and efficacy of atezolizumab subcutaneous (SC) compared with atezolizumab intravenous (IV) in participants with locally advanced or metastatic Non-Small Cell Lung Cancer (NSCLC) who have not been exposed to cancer immunotherapy (CIT) and for whom prior platinum-based therapy has failed. The study is comprised of two parts, as follows: A dose-finding part (Part 1, Phase Ib) will aim to identify the dose of atezolizumab SC to be tested in Part 2. A dose-confirmation part (Part 2, Phase III, randomized) will aim to confirm that the dose moved forward from Part 1 yields drug exposure that is comparable to that of atezolizumab IV.

NCT ID: NCT03731559 Recruiting - HIV/TB Coinfection Clinical Trials

Efficacy, Safety and Pharmacokinetics of DTG With RIF

Start date: June 25, 2019
Phase: Phase 2
Study type: Interventional

The overall aim of the project is to evaluate optimal DTG dose for the combined treatment of TB and HIV infections with RIF based anti-TB therapy. This Stage II trial will determine precisely the PK parameters of DTG in combination with RIF regimen in Thai HIV/TB co-infected patients. After the optimal dose of DTG has been found, it will be further tested in a larger Stage III trial to assess its safety, tolerability and efficacy when used with RIF based regimen.
